New Delhi: Cricket fraternity of Sunday paid rich tributes to Indian cricket administrator Jagmohan Dalmiya, who passed away late in the evening in Kolkata.

The BCCI boss, 75, had suffered heart attack on Thursday and was under observation after undergoing a heart surgery. He is survived by his wife, his son Abhishek and a daughter.

Anurag Thakur, the BCCI secretary, was one of the first to condole the loss.

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i spared thoughts for Dalmiya's family.

West Bengal chief minister Mamata Banerjee also paid his respect.

Indian batting maestro, Sachin Tendulkar, said he "Will always cherish his encouragement & support over the years."

Former India batsman, VVS Laxman hailed him as "a visionary".
